Why models scheme: researcher traces deceptive behavior to unwieldy pretraining data
_arohan_ · x · 2026-09-13
AI researcher arohan argues that models' tendency to scheme and hack other companies is learned from pretraining itself — the large-scale corpus is too unwieldy, so better alignment ultimately requires better training recipes rather than post-hoc fixes.
He cites the essay "Tabula Rasa" from Convergent Thinking, which draws an analogy to child development: what reaches a child during formation is chosen, graded and sequenced, and that sequencing is itself an intervention. A model trained on the whole internet doesn't become safe afterwards — "every correction is itself a mark."
